Newcastle and Tottenham among seven Premier League clubs interested in 2021 Super Eagles invitee

It has been reported that Newcastle and Tottenham are in the running to sign 2021 Super Eagles invitee Michael Olise.


According to HITC, the two aforementioned clubs alongside Arsenal, Manchester City, Manchester United, Liverpool, and Chelsea have approached the player's representatives about signing him.

 
Aston Villa are also said to be an admirer of the Super Eagles-eligible forward but are already exploring another alternative in Villarreal's Alex Baena.


The report also claimed that Olise would prefer to stay in London where he was born but he is not averse to the idea of moving elsewhere with PSG, Barcelona, and Atlético de Madrid also monitoring his situation.

 

The French youth international has a release clause that is said to be more than £50m which might indicate that the club with the best financial offer will grasp his signature.

 

Thus, it remains to be seen whether Tottenham and particularly Newcastle who are limited by Financial Fair Play regulations can go head to head with other English giants for the signing of Olise.


A move to Spurs would see the versatile forward compete with Dejan Kulusevski and Brennan Johnson for a starting role on the right flank of the attack while he will have Miguel Almirón to contend with if he joins the Magpies.
